Bodysnatcher announces March 2023 US Headlining Tour

by newseditor
December 6, 2022
in News
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Bodysnatcher US Tour 2023 posterFlorida deathcore outfit Bodysnatcher, who just wrapped up a US tour supporting Hatebreed, will return to the road in March 2023 on a US headlining run. The month-long Big Team Battle Tour will commence on March 1st in West Palm, Florida and run through March 29th in Worcester, Massachusetts with support provided by Angelmaker, Paleface, and Distant.

Comments vocalist Kyle Medina: “We are extremely excited to finally be able to announce our headlining tour with some of our favorite bands in heavy music. We couldn’t be more stoked to bring out our friends Angelmaker from Canada, Paleface from Switzerland, and Distant from Slovakia! Every band brings such a badass live show as well as positive attitudes. We will be playing a good spread of our catalog of music from the previous three albums and have some very awesome tour exclusive merch designs that we think everyone will lose their minds over as well as some exclusive VIP items available for purchase when tickets go on sale. Be on the lookout for an additional announcement regarding the end of this tour, as we think everyone will be ecstatic once that is revealed”!

Bodysnatcher’s latest full-length, “Bleed-Abide”, was released earlier this year on MNRK Heavy. Recorded by the band’s Chris Whited at 1776 Recordings with drums engineered by Neil Westfall and Bud Phillips at The Unicorn Room, and guitars re-amped by Phil Pluskota at Sonic Assault Studio, the record is callously grim, ferocious, and threatening, crackling beneath the weight of its own fury and power. Bodysnatcher’s “Bleed-Abide” puts the “core” back in deathcore.

“Bleed-Abide” is available now on CD, LP, cassette, and digital formats, here.

Line-up:
Kyle Medina – Vocals
Kyle Carter – Guitar
Kyle Shope – Bass
Chris Whited – Drums
